How much do senior process engineer jobs pay per year?

As of Jul 4, 2026, the average yearly pay for senior process engineer in Ohio is $115,145.00, according to ZipRecruiter salary data. Most workers in this role earn between $98,900.00 and $127,900.00 per year, depending on experience, location, and employer.

What is the difference between Senior Process Engineer vs Process Engineer?

AspectSenior Process EngineerProcess Engineer
QualificationsBachelor's or Master's in Engineering, often with 5+ years experienceBachelor's degree in Engineering or related field, typically 1-3 years experience
ResponsibilitiesLeading process improvements, mentoring, project managementSupporting process development, data analysis, assisting senior staff
Work EnvironmentDesign teams, manufacturing plants, R&D departmentsManufacturing facilities, engineering teams, operational support

Senior Process Engineers typically have more experience, leadership duties, and oversee complex projects, while Process Engineers focus on supporting process development and implementation. Both roles are essential in manufacturing and engineering industries, but the senior role involves greater responsibility and strategic planning.

What are the key skills and qualifications needed to thrive as a Senior Process Engineer, and why are they important?

To thrive as a Senior Process Engineer, you need a strong background in chemical or process engineering, problem-solving skills, and typically a bachelor's or master's degree in a relevant field. Expertise in process simulation software (such as Aspen Plus or HYSYS), Six Sigma or Lean certifications, and familiarity with process control systems are highly valued. Outstanding analytical abilities, leadership, and effective communication set top performers apart in this role. These skills and qualifications are crucial for optimizing processes, ensuring safety and compliance, and leading teams to achieve operational excellence.

What does a Senior Process Engineer do?

A Senior Process Engineer is responsible for designing, optimizing, and overseeing processes within manufacturing or production environments. They analyze workflows, troubleshoot issues, and implement improvements to increase efficiency, safety, and product quality. Senior Process Engineers often lead projects, mentor junior engineers, and collaborate with cross-functional teams to ensure operational excellence. Their expertise is vital in industries like chemicals, pharmaceuticals, oil and gas, and food processing.

What are some common challenges Senior Process Engineers face when working on cross-functional teams?

Senior Process Engineers often collaborate with professionals from various departments, such as operations, quality, and maintenance. A common challenge is aligning diverse priorities and communication styles to achieve shared project goals. Successfully managing these differences requires strong interpersonal and project management skills, as well as the ability to translate technical concepts for non-engineering colleagues. Regular meetings and clear documentation can help ensure everyone stays informed and engaged throughout the process.
